Role Overview

Job Overview

Qualcomm India Private Limited is hiring a Senior Engineer - Audio DSP in Bangalore for an embedded software engineering role focused on next-generation voice and music solutions. The position is part of Qualcomm's Engineering Group and involves developing, integrating, porting, debugging, and optimizing audio software for production platforms.

The engineer will work on audio codecs and DSP software across ARM and HiFi DSP platforms. The role combines embedded C/C++ development, audio signal processing, fixed-point arithmetic, system-level audio integration, and performance optimization. Engineers will work with real hardware, investigate complex audio behavior, and collaborate with platform, interface, customer, and cross-functional teams to deliver reliable audio solutions.

Required Skills

Candidates should have practical experience developing embedded or DSP audio software and a strong understanding of C/C++ for resource-constrained systems. The role requires familiarity with ARM and HiFi DSP architectures or equivalent DSP platforms, along with the ability to develop performance-critical code.

A solid foundation in audio signal processing and codec fundamentals is important. Relevant concepts include MDCT, quantization, psychoacoustics, and bitstream structures. Experience with audio codec development or integration is particularly relevant, including technologies such as AAC, LC3, SBC, and CVSD.

The position also requires hands-on knowledge of fixed-point arithmetic and embedded optimization. Candidates should understand how software changes affect execution speed, MCPS, code size, memory usage, latency, and power consumption. Strong debugging, analytical thinking, and problem-solving skills are essential for investigating issues on real hardware platforms.


Preferred Skills

Experience with HiFi DSP, ARM DSP extensions, or comparable DSP architectures is valuable. Familiarity with embedded audio frameworks, DSP frameworks, and operating-system audio stacks can further strengthen an application. Knowledge of digital audio interfaces and formats such as PCM, I2S, and SPDIF is also relevant.

Understanding RTOS concepts, including tasks, queues, semaphores, and scheduling, is useful for embedded audio development. Exposure to customer support, platform enablement, or ecosystem integration is another advantage. Experience working with Python, MATLAB, and Makefiles can support development, automation, analysis, and engineering workflows.

Previous work on Qualcomm or CSR platforms is listed as a plus. Experience collaborating with multi-site or cross-geography engineering teams is also beneficial.
